Abstract
The utility model provides an induction cooker which comprises a casing, a vibration pickup and a thermistor. The vibration pickup and the thermistor are fixed on an inner side wall of the casing in an attaching manner. A buzzing alarm is further mounted in the casing, an LED (light-emitting diode) alarm light is arranged on an outer side wall of the casing, and the vibration pickup, the thermistor, the buzzing alarm and the LED alarm light are connected onto a control panel of the induction cooker through leads. The induction cooker is accurate in measurement and quick in response. By the aid of the vibration pickup and the thermistor, temperature of a cooker body and boiling of water are detected, so that whether the water is boiled or not can be quickly and reliably judged; and by the aid of a voice warning and an LED warning, effective warning is achieved.

Background technology
Electromagnetic oven has another name called electromagnetic stove, adopt the principle of magnetic field induction eddy heating for heating, utilize electric current to produce magnetic field by coil, when the bottom of the magnetic line of force in the magnetic field by metalware, can produce countless little eddy current, make the self-heating of vessel own, thus the food in the heating vessel.In heating process, there is not naked light, so safety, health.Electromagnetic oven is because conveniences such as its multifunctionalities, cleaning, safety, convenience, and becomes in the modern kitchen the generally kitchen tools of use.
When the user uses electromagnetic oven boiling water or Baoshang, be easy to produce and boil or the overflow problem, in addition the circuit for generating fault, the use safety that threatens the user.Thereby the measurement of temperature of boiler especially measurement and the early warning of water boiling just seem particularly important.

As shown in Figure 1, a kind of electromagnetic oven, comprise housing 1, also comprise and adhere to a vibration pickup 2 and a thermistor 3 that is fixed on described housing 1 madial wall, one buzzer siren 4 also is installed in the described housing, housing 1 lateral wall is provided with a LED alarm lamp 5, and this vibration pickup 2, thermistor 3, buzzer siren 4 and LED alarm lamp 5 are connected to the control panel 6 of electromagnetic oven by lead-in wire.
The vibration that described vibration pickup 2 causes during the water boiling in can the induction kettle body, thus vibration signal is sent to control panel 6 by lead-in wire, and this vibration induction is not subjected to the interference of ambient temperature.3 of thermistors are to responsive to temperature, and are highly sensitive, are used with vibration pickup 2, make measurement result have double shield, avoid false alarm, more reliable.
The control panel 6 of described electromagnetic oven comprises amplifying circuit and a single-chip microcomputer.Described vibration pickup 2, thermistor 3 detected signals amplify by amplifying circuit, are sent to single-chip microcomputer and analyze judgement.If single-chip microcomputer is judged the water in the pot body and is in fluidized state, then send alarm command to buzzer siren 4 and LED alarm lamp 5 by lead-in wire, buzzer siren 4 warning that pipes, LED alarm lamp 5 glimmers simultaneously, notes with prompting user.
